Predicted to enable mRNA 3'-UTR binding activity and mRNA base-pairing translational repressor activity. Predicted to be involved in several processes, including negative regulation of cell adhesion molecule production; negative regulation of cell migration involved in sprouting angiogenesis; and regulation of gene expression. Predicted to act upstream of or within several processes, including cellular response to estrogen stimulus; cellular response to leukemia inhibitory factor; and sensory perception of sound. Predicted to be located in nucleus. Predicted to be part of RISC complex. Biomarker of alcohol use disorder. Human ortholog(s) of this gene implicated in stomach cancer. Orthologous to human MIR206 (microRNA 206); INTERACTS WITH 2,5-hexanedione; atrazine; cadmium dichloride.
